red930 Posted December 4, 2006 Posted December 4, 2006 How low can one go in terms of wattage for one 8800 GTX? Nvidia says 450 watts for a single card, but the recommended values are usually too lenient. I just bought my Corsair HX 520 and I kind of didn't want to upgrade again, if I can't even hope to run a 8800 on it I'll settle for one of the upcoming 8600s. Runs fine on both a PC Power & Cooling 510 ASL and an Antec True Power Trio 550. Not sure on the Corsair, I'd assume that since the 620 is more powerful than it seems that the 550 is similar, but I really don't know.
